Green light appears out of nowhere in night sky

I was outside smoking a cigerette when I still smoked cigarettes, looking at the sky. Sitting on my steps I was looking straight at the skyline. It was about 10pm, and dark.

All of a sudden I saw a green light flash across the sky. It came out of nowhere. If you stuck your arms out to measure the distance it travelled, it would have been about a foot between my arms as a measure. It seemed to appear at the same height as the stars, and shot across the sky then disappeared. Was this a shooting star or a comet? I don't know. Are comets or shooting stars a green blob circle of light that shoots across the sky? I've seen shooting stars and a meteor shower before. Neither were green. And though I could not tell how high up this was. The intensity of the green light makes me think that it was not as high as the stars, possibly in the higher parts of our atmosphere. That's my gut feeling.

Did I see a alien ship? I t's a possibility.
